Solar energy subsidy faces more cuts

The subsidy for household solar systems faces a fresh series of cuts this year, and could plunge to about a third of recent levels, under government changes announced on Thursday.

But ministers have more than doubled the pot of money available for subsidies, raising it to as much as £2.2bn up to 2015, according to the Department of Energy and Climate Change.”
